Mudjacking services involve the process of l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the slab. This technique typically uses a slurry made of cement, sand, soil, and water, which is pumped through small holes drilled into the concrete. Once beneath the surface, the mixture fills voids and raises the slab to its proper position, restoring stability and a level appearance. The procedure is often considered a cost-effective alternative to replacing entire concrete sections, providing a relatively quick solution for uneven surfaces.

This service addresses common problems such as uneven walkways, cracked driveways, sinking patios, or uneven garage floors. When soil beneath a concrete slab shifts or settles over time, it can lead to dangerous tripping hazards, water pooling, or structural issues. Mudjacking helps to stabilize these surfaces, preventing further deterioration and reducing the risk of accidents. By restoring the original elevation of the concrete, mudjacking can improve the safety, functionality, and appearance of outdoor and indoor concrete features.

Cost Range - M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 for residential driveways and sidewalks. Larger or more complex projects may exceed $2,000 depending on the scope and location. Prices vary based on the size and condition of the area being raised.

Factors Influencing Price - The overall cost depends on the size of the area, the severity of the sinking, and accessibility. For example, a small patio might cost around $500, while a large garage floor could reach $2,500 or more.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Expect to pay approximately $3 to $6 per square foot for mudjacking services. This rate can fluctuate based on the region and the contractor’s pricing policies. Larger projects often benefit from lower per-square-foot costs.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face repairs, sealing, or crack filling, which can add several hundred dollars to the total. Some providers include these services in their initial quotes, while others charge separately based on the work required.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is mudjacking? Mudjacking is a process where a mixture of soil, cement, or other materials is injected beneath a slab to lift and level it.

How do I know if my concrete needs mudjacking? Signs include uneven surfaces, cracks, or sinking slabs that affect safety and usability.

How long does mudjacking typically take? The procedure usually takes a few hours, depending on the size and extent of the repair area.

Is mudjacking a permanent solution? Mudjacking can provide a long-lasting fix, but the durability depends on underlying soil conditions and proper installation by local pros.
